Transaction 22037607861ba81d9e76ac581aee68307122eb21b7edd71602ef7236a79d19a5
1 Input
1 Output
-
22037607861ba81d9e76ac581aee68307122eb21b7edd71602ef7236a79d19a5:0
- value
- 698
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9832cb495317f1b679fc26d2726431388f95e7fb887620d0bc0361965609d0f6
- address
- bc1pnqevkj2nzlcmv70uymf8yep38z8etelm3pmzp59uqdsev4sf6rmq0krr3w